German Translation of “force”

force (fɔːs Pronunciation for force

Translations

noun

  1. (no plural)(= physical strength, power) (physics) Kraft feminine noun
    1. [of blow, impact] Wucht feminine noun
      1. (= physical coercion) Gewalt feminine noun
     ⇒ to resort to force Gewalt anwenden ⇒ by or through sheer force of numbers aufgrund zahlenmäßiger Überlegenheit ⇒ there is a force 5 wind blowing es herrscht Windstärke 5 ⇒ they were there in force sie waren in großer Zahl da ⇒ to come into/be in force in Kraft treten/sein
  2. (no plural) (figurative)
    1. [of argument] Überzeugungskraft feminine noun
    2. [of character] Stärke feminine noun
    3. [of words] Macht feminine noun
     ⇒ by or from force of habit aus Gewohnheit ⇒ the force of circumstances der Druck der Verhältnisse
  3. (= powerful thing, person) Macht feminine noun ⇒ there are various forces at work here hier sind verschiedene Kräfte am Werk ⇒ he is a powerful force in the reform movement er ist ein einflussreicher Mann in der Reformbewegung
  4. (= body of men) the forces (military) die Streitkräfte plural noun ⇒ the (police) force die Polizei ⇒ to join forces sich zusammentun

transitive verb

  1. (= compel) zwingen ⇒ to force sb/oneself to do sth jdn/sich zwingen, etw zu tun ⇒ he was forced to conclude that ... er sah sich zu der Folgerung gezwungen or gedrängt, dass ... ⇒ to force sth (up)on sb present, one's company jdm etw aufdrängen conditions, obedience, jdm etw auferlegen decision, war, jdm etw aufzwingen ⇒ he forced himself on her (sexually) er tat ihr Gewalt an ⇒ to force a smile gezwungen lächeln ⇒ don't force it erzwingen Sie es nicht
  2. (= extort, obtain by force) erzwingen ⇒ he forced a confession out of or from me er erzwang ein Geständnis von mir ⇒ to force an error (sport) einen Fehler erzwingen
  3. (= break open) aufbrechen
  4. (= push, squeeze) to force books into a box Bücher in eine Kiste zwängen ⇒ if it won't open/go in, don't force it wenn es nicht aufgeht/passt, wende keine Gewalt an ⇒ to force one's way into sth sich dative gewaltsam Zugang zu etw or in etw accusative verschaffen ⇒ to force a car off the road ein Auto von der Fahrbahn drängen
